At Blue Cube, we combine best-in-class blast freezing and portable cold storage solutions with exceptional customer service.
As our Internal Service Co-ordinator, you’ll ensure any on-site technical issues are resolved swiftly, keeping our clients up and running.
What you’ll do
✓ Answer incoming calls, assess the nature of each enquiry and either action directly or escalate to our Sales or Accounts team
✓ Organise on-site technical support for customers
✓ Task our mobile engineering team with breakdowns and follow-on work
✓ Assist the Tuxford depot with service administration and customer liaison
✓ Coordinate with our out-of-hours (OOH) provider ensuring all OOH calls are logged and collected accurately
✓ Communicate on-call rota changes to the OOH provider as required
✓ Handle OOH performance queries or complaints and deliver satisfactory outcomes to customers
✓ Issue job worksheets, review completed worksheets and update CRM with next steps
✓ Close internal service records upon job completion, ensuring customers receive a copy
✓ Handle any customer complaints, carry out relevant investigation and achieve customer satisfaction
✓ Manage fleet assist service requirements – book sites, maintain internal records and keep customers informed as jobs progress.
✓ Create and track internal POs for parts, log all POs in the accounts spreadsheet and review month-end PO reports.
✓ Handle supplier and subcontractor invoices – code correctly and deal with queries
✓ Source and order parts ad hoc, explore alternative suppliers, and manage gas supply logistics
✓ Liaise daily with supplier on warranty issues, maintain service schedules and coordinate bookings as our main customer contact
✓ Maintain accurate internal records of fleet assets
✓ Maintain engineer calendars to streamline workflow and maximise customer satisfaction
✓ Prepare and send RAMs to customers, and ensure all engineer job cards and parts data are logged
